Du Juan

Du Juan

Du Juan's Rating: 8.27/10info

Based on 39 votes from Hotness Rater voters

Won Against

  • Clara Bow
    7.92/10
    leighann ex gf
    7.77/10
    Gabriella Wilde
    7.72/10
  • Sarah Shahi
    Unrated
    Lara Stone
    Unrated

Lost Against

  • Qin Li
    7.99/10
    Gemma Ward
    7.71/10
    Dongdong Xu
    Unrated
  • Juliette Perkins
    Unrated